Briquette LMS
A multi-tenant learning system for a bioinformatics course, shaped around roles, modules, submissions, and live communication.
Learning system
The problem
A technical course needed one dependable place for administrators, teachers, and students to move through content, work, feedback, and communication without losing the thread.
Decisions
- Model roles and tenant boundaries before polishing screens.
- Keep course modules, submissions, grading, and communication in one understandable flow.
- Treat security, backups, and operational runbooks as part of the product.

What I learned
- A learning product is an orchestration problem before it is a component problem.
- The most useful interface is often the one that makes the next responsibility obvious.
